Campbell County vs Fayette County

Dominating Northern Kentucky's scenic Ohio River border, Campbell County, with Alexandria as its seat, offers a unique balance of accessibility and natural landscapes. Its proximity to Cincinnati and rolling hills presents opportunities for those seeking a rural retreat with convenient urban access. Fayette County is home to Lexington, Kentucky's second-largest city and the heart of the Bluegrass Region. Known for horse farms, rolling pastures, and strong land values, Fayette County offers urban amenities alongside agricultural heritage. County seat: Lexington.
